    RAYMOND — The men’s soccer program at Hinds Community College was recently recognized for its work in the academic field by being named a recipient of the 2007-2008 National Soccer Coaches Association of America (NSCAA)/adidas Men’s Team Academic Award.

    CHESTER — Developers of the planned Chester soccer stadium have withdrawn a request to expandtheir tax-exempt building zone after it became clear they would be unable to strike a deal with the Chester Upland School District before an end-of-the-year deadline.
